The sheared vertical stablizer is for now unremarkable.
In normal cruise and climb, even through turbulence, the use of rudder is limited. On this particular aircraft, yaw control is augmented by the FBW system and yaw damper.
While the ACARS readout does show a degradation from Normal Law to Alternate Law, and the warning regarding the Rudder Travel Limiter (most likely from the ADIRU failures), there is no reason the PF would from that point forward have begun stomping on the rudder pedals willy nilly.
